A compensation package is the combination of salary and fringe benefits an employer provides to an employee. When evaluating competing job offers, a job-seeker should consider the total package and not just salary.

There is almost an unlimited number of potential benefits packages offered by employers. Some employers offer them at the employee's expense, some pay all of the costs, some pay part of the costs. Benefits include such things as vacation days, sick days, personal days, paid company holidays, pension plans, stock ownership plans, health insurance, dental/eye insurance, life insurance, and more.

Salary-Based Compensation: Under this provision, the Medical Director's compensation is determined based on a fixed annual salary. This approach ensures a consistent and predetermined income for the Medical Director throughout the contract period. Factors such as experience, qualifications, and responsibilities may influence the salary amount. 2. Performance-Based Incentives: Some health care agencies in Fairfax, Virginia, may incorporate performance-based incentives into a Medical Director's contract. This provision enables the Medical Director to earn additional compensation based on achieving predefined performance goals such as patient satisfaction, quality metrics, and financial targets. These incentives motivate the Medical Director to excel in their role and enhance the overall performance of the health care agency. 3. Fee-for-Service Compensation: In certain cases, compensation for Medical Directors in Fairfax, Virginia, can be structured using a fee-for-service model. This provision ensures that the Medical Director is compensated for each service provided, such as conducting medical evaluations, consulting on cases, or participating in administrative duties. The fee-for-service model often aligns the compensation with the level of service provided and can be calculated either on a per-hour or per-service basis. 4. Part-Time vs. Full-Time Contracts: Depending on the needs and resources of the health care agency, Fairfax, Virginia, offers provisions for both part-time and full-time Medical Director contracts. Part-time contracts may include flexible working hours and reduced responsibilities leading to a proportionally adjusted compensation package. Full-time contracts, on the other hand, typically attract a higher compensation as they involve a larger time commitment and increased responsibilities.
